
Episode 11. Tegan Connolly
04/13/23 • 38 min
Tegan Connolly is a mother with an inspiring story to share. Battling leukaemia at the tender age of two and a half, Tegan's son Logan is now thriving and cancer-free.
Strap yourselves in listeners and get ready to be uplifted as Tegan shares his triumphant fight against the disease. Plus, hear how her new career path was inspired by her son's cancer journey.
